4855 Spider-Man's Train Rescue is a Spider-Man 2 set released in 2004. It comes with a train on a train track, Doc Ock, Spider-Man, J. Jonah Jameson, and a Subway Train Conductor.
Description[]
If the slammer is slammed while the train is next to it, it will get sent down the track into the spider webs. The newspaper is exclusive to the set with a new decorative printing saying, "Doc Ock Still At Large!". Two translucent spiders are also included in this set.

Notes[]
- For some reason J. Jonah Jameson is in this set though he is absent from the scene in the film.
- It is included in 65572 Spider-Man Combined Set.
